The Coral Springs Museum of Art welcomed nearly 300 South Florida art enthusiasts to unveil new exhibits by three artists.
During the event held on December 6, guests interacted with artists Judi Regal, Daniel Garcia, and photographer Luis Castañeda while enjoying cocktails sponsored by Bacardi.
Judi Regal’s contemporary works focus on light, texture and the interplay of color and form. Luis Castañeda’s exhibit, “Danzzaria,” features black-and-white photography from the Ballet Nacional de Cuba, and Daniel Garcia blurs all the lines created by society and invites you to explore his different, perfectly imperfect world of art.
Garcia’s exhibit will be on display at the Coral Springs Museum of Art through December 23, 2017, and Regal’s and Castañeda’s exhibits will be on display through March 3, 2018.
The Coral Springs Museum of Art is open Tuesday through Saturday 10 a.m. – 5 p.m. Admission is $6 and members are free. Located at 2855 Coral Springs Dr. Suite A, Coral Springs, FL 33065
